It's from Knocked Up. A longer portion of it is on the half-hour mockumentary on the two-disc DVD in which Judd Apatow goes through a slew of actors of the role Seth Rogen ultimately plays in the movie (including James Franco, Orlando Bloom, Danny McBride, and others).
I am of fan of Cera's, so I'll be there; despite the reviews from test screenings being very lukewarm (Cera's performance is getting raves, but the rest of the film is said to be pretty mediocre).

I hate to be the early naysayer, but the film just didn't work for me. A lot comes from me not being able to accept their relationship. I get why he digs the girl (aka she's hot) but the film didn't convince me at all why she would immediately submit to him and turn hot and heavy, head over heels in love.
There are definitely funny parts (and one particular moment of hilarity involving a car), but so much of the story is predicated on his keep-the-girl-at-all-costs drive that not having that bond be believable went a long way to killing the story for me.
